What was the very last Beatles album?
Let It Be
Abbey Road was the last they recorded, but Let It Be was the last they released.

What Beatles song was number one the longest?
Hey Jude
“Hey Jude” was The Beatles’ number one hit that spent the longest on the charts. “Hey Jude” reached No. 1 on September 28, 1968, and spent 19 weeks on the charts.
